Exterior foundation services involve inspecting, repairing, and strengthening the visible parts of a building’s foundation that are exposed above ground. These services typically include tasks such as sealing cracks, installing or replacing waterproofing barriers, and addressing surface damage caused by weather or age. Proper exterior foundation work helps protect the structure from water intrusion, soil movement, and other environmental factors that can compromise the integrity of the foundation over time. Homeowners who notice signs of damage or want to proactively maintain their property often turn to local contractors specializing in exterior foundation services to ensure their home remains stable and secure.
Many common problems can be addressed through exterior foundation services. Cracks in the foundation wall may allow water to seep into the basement or crawl space, leading to moisture issues and potential mold growth. Water pooling around the foundation can cause soil erosion or shifting, which may result in uneven floors or structural stress. Additionally, damaged or deteriorated waterproofing can leave the foundation vulnerable to water damage during heavy rains or snowmelt. These issues often become apparent through visible cracks, water stains, or dampness in basement areas, signaling the need for professional exterior foundation repairs to prevent further damage.

The overview below groups typical Exterior Foundation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in North Branch, MN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or foundation repairs in North Branch often range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es, such as small crack repairs or patching, fall within this middle range.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.
Foundation Waterproofing - Local service providers usually charge between $1,000 and $3,500 for waterproofing a foundation. Larger or more complex waterproofing projects can reach $4,000+ but are less common for standard jobs.
Foundation Stabilization - Stabilization services, including pier and beam work, typically cost between $2,000 and $7,000. Many projects land in the mid-range, with larger, more involved projects potentially exceeding $10,000.
Full Foundation Replacement - Complete foundation replacement in North Branch can vary widely, generally falling between $20,000 and $50,000. Larger, more complex replacements can go beyond this range, but most projects are within the lower to mid part of this sp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
